This book is the essential resource for anyone teaching students in grades 3-5 to navigate informational text. Based on Rozlyns popular Common Core workshops, this guide walks you through each informational text reading standard, aligns each standard to research-based strategies, and explicitly shows you how to introduce and model those strategies in your classroom. Filled with practical techniques, anchor charts, reproducible graphic organizers,...

What happens when Cinderella wears the shoes she's made from recycled materials to the ball? Tap into students' sense of humor with five lively plays that take the plots, characters, and settings of traditional fairy tales and turn them on their heads! Includes character roles written at a variety of reading levels, book links, and writing activities that help students build on traditional fairy tale structures and write in different genres.
